Harley-Davidson teases its 2025 models.

harley will unveil its new models in around twenty days' time. In the meantime, the American manufacturer presents the first models in its 2025 collection. The Road King Special, Street Glide and Road Glide have been renewed, with no changes other than a few new colors.

only three models from the Grand Touring range are presented. As for Trikes, the Freewheeler and Tri Glide Ultra are sure to be back in dealerships. Some twenty models should be unveiled shortly.

moCo also announced Harley-Davidson Factory Custom Paint & Graphics, a new program offering highly sought-after paint and graphics on selected motorcycle models. Additional Harley-Davidson 2025 models, including the 26th annual variation of the limited-edition Custom Vehicle Operation (CVO ) collection, will be presented at 5 p.m. on January 23.

but what's this new Harley-Davidson Factory Custom Paint & Graphics idea all about? It offers high-end paints and graphics for selected motorcycle models, aimed at customers looking for a unique and spectacular finish. When ordered through an authorized Harley-Davidson dealer, components with a Harley-Davidson Factory Custom Paint & Graphics finish are painted by Harley-Davidson and installed directly during motorcycle assembly. The customer thus receives a motorcycle with exclusive paint and graphics, backed by a full factory warranty, without the costs and delays associated with a third-party custom paint job.

for 2025, three Harley-Davidson Factory Custom Paint & Graphics finishes will be offered on selected models. Each paint package features a special black tank medallion with chrome accents and a pearlescent textured background in purple or orange.

  • Mystic Shift offers a spectacular change of hue from dark metallic to violet, blue and almost orange. This effect is particularly noticeable in bright sunlight as you move around the bike.
  • Firestorm responds to a current trend for flame details in custom paintwork. Harley-Davidson introduced its first factory paintwork with a flame pattern on the 1980 Wide Glide model, and has repeated the look several times, including on the 2011 Wide Glide model. Firestorm patterns feature a ghostly gradient effect, or interior gradient: the gradient color is slightly lighter than the base coat. From certain angles, the flames appear spectacular, but remain subtle from others. Firestorm patterns are available in two popular colors:
  • Midnight Firestorm is a dark paint with ghostly flames on a Vivid Black base and a charcoal inner glow.
  • Whiskey Firestorm features an added mid-coat for a deeper orange hue, with Ember Sunglo ghost flames and a brighter orange inner glow.
